Keanu Reeves was seen looking very different on a film set Keanu Reeves has just unveiled a huge new hair transformation, and he still looks seriously suave. Over the last few years, we’ve seen the John Wick icon rocking a sleek, shoulder-length ‘do which has become his trademark. But the 59-year-old appears to have undergone the chop for his new role in upcoming flick, Outcome.
Little else is known about the plot, but Cameron Diaz was recently confirmed to be in final negotiations to join the cast beside Jonah Hill, who is also serving as director. He ditched his longer hairdo Keanu is set to be very busy as it was previously confirmed that fans would officially get their hands on another John Wick sequel. The fourth movie in the blockbuster franchise hit the big screen last year and was an instant hit at the box office, raking in a whopping $440million.
